Brief Summary: The goal of this study is to compare a sample of the cyst taken by a standard method fine needle aspiration to the sample taken by a new method using a device called the EchoBrush to see which method is more accurate at diagnosing cancer We will also look at proteins also called biomarkers in the samples to see if they predict whether or not the cyst is cancerous
Detailed Description: Patients who meet the inclusion and exclusion criteria will be offered the study and those who consent will undergo Endoscopic Ultrasound EUS evaluation All patients who consent to the study will undergo Endoscopic Ultrasound guided fine needle aspiration EUS-FNA and EUS guided EchoBrush All patients will receive the recommended standard antibiotic prophylaxis Ciprofloxacin 400 mg IV given 30 minutes prior to EUS that is used prior to EUS-FNA of cystic pancreatic lesions and a prescription for oral Ciprofloxacin for 5 days post procedure standard of care

Participants with pancreatic cysts that are 10 mm but under 25 mm These patients will undergo standard EUS-FNA of cyst fluid From the first 19 participants 05cc of aspirated cyst fluid will be sent for Proteomic analysis and the rest for cytology EUS guided EchoBrush of the cyst wall will not be performed in this group of patients

Participants with pancreatic cysts that are 25 mm will undergo EUS guided Echobrush sampling of the cyst wall at the same time they undergo EUS-FNA This will be done using the standard technique that is described below

EUS guided cyst wall brushing and residual fluid aspirated after lavage with 2 cc of sterile normal saline The tip of the Echobrush and the saline used to lavage the cyst will be placed in the same specimen jar Specimen 2 based on the discussion with published experts on the EchoBrush technique It should be noted that the pancreatic cyst will be punctured with the 19G FNA needle only once to obtain the specimens mentioned above A single pass with EUS-FNA is the standard of care for pancreatic cysts and this study does not alter standard of care It should be noted that the two groups represent two samples from the same patient and same cystic lesion Therefore each patient will serve as their own internal control All patients will be considered for surgical resection Patients who do not undergo surgical resection will be followed up per standard of care
